I have 2 Budgies My males name is Joey Beaks and my little girl is Miss Lucy. My Newest Addition Oscar the Love bird.
I just got this lovely little guy 3 days ago. He is quite different then my budgies but in a really good way. He is so playful, all he wants to do is have fun. I have only ever had budgies so this is a new adventure for me. We are off to a very good start but I think he needs a bigger cage. I have a 18L 18H 14W. Please if anyone knows better then I do because I feel he might need bigger.
Any other advice is welcome.

Lovebirds are smaller parrots like a GCC but 18x18x14 seems kind of small to me too. I'd step up to a medium at lest something like 24x24x24 more or less it doesn't have to be immediate, but I'd invest in it, he will be living there a long time.

You are right the cage is too small for a lovebird, or even a budgie. I would recommend getting the largest cage you can afford. The bigger the better!! I also notice that you were using plastic perches which are bad for their feet, so get some varied surfaces for your bird to perch on such as natural wood, cement, rope, and calcium perches.
